# Quillpress Environments

Quillpress, our markdown rendering pipeline, runs in three environments: sandbox, staging, and production. Support should reproduce rendering bugs in sandbox first, since staging shares a cache with production and can mask stale-fragment issues. Each environment differs only in its configuration; the production values are listed below.

settings of fafog-haduf:
ZORIX_PIN=4648
ZORIX_METRICS_HOST=metrics.zorix.paliqsys.corp
ZORIX_LOG_LEVEL=info
ZORIX_TENANT=druix

# ChipGate Reader — Environments

Three environments: dev (simulated mat pings), staging (replayed race traffic from the Harwell Marathon archive), prod (live events). Code must pass staging replay before merge. Prod deploys freeze 48h before race day. Reviewers: check env-specific overrides, not just defaults. The staging configuration currently in effect is shown below.

service settings:
quenath:
  pin: 3939
  metrics_host: metrics.quenath.qorvellabs.internal
  tenant: aldiel
  seal: seal_91ee6627

// Driver-assignment heuristic for the Copperline dispatch service.
// We score each candidate driver by weighted distance, acceptance history,
// and current queue depth, then assign greedily. This is intentionally
// simple: the optimizer team in Varsten owns the batch re-balancer, and
// this path only handles real-time requests. Changing weights here shifts
// load across zones, so coordinate with dispatch ops before edits.
// The weights and thresholds in effect are defined below.

tuning constants:
RATE_LIMITS = {
    "ralwyn": 2,
    "druath": 10,
    "ralix": 1,
    "quenath": 10,
}

## Fan-out stall: Gustline alerts

If weather alerts queue but don't fan out, check the Brinmoor dispatcher first. Restart it; do not restart the ingest node. Confirm subscriber counts recover within two minutes. If not, drain the dead-letter queue and replay. Escalate only after one replay attempt. Log every action with the dispatcher's current build token, shown below.

pipeline stamp: htk3_69f